What Work You Will be Responsible For:
Coordinate, plan, and supervise multiple engagements including consulting, compliance, and tax planning services.
Prepare federal, state, and multi-state income tax returns.
Conduct research and planning according to applicable tax laws and regulations.
Respond appropriately to IRS and state tax notices.
Communicate with clients as directed by Manager or Supervisor.
Work as part of an integrated team.
Assist with training and mentoring of new Associates.
Basic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ting or equivalent field.
2+ years of experience within accounting and/or tax.
Experience within a public accounting firm.
Preferred/Desired Qualifications:
Master's Degree in Taxation or relevant field.
Experience with ProSystem FX, CCH Engagement, XCM, or similar software.
CPA certification.
